Sunday, January 17, 2010

Dozens from across Wichita joined together at the Unitarian Universalist Church in east Wichita for a candlelight vigil honoring those suffering in Haiti.

Reverend David Carter said, "When this news came to me, I thought what can we do?"

Carter decided he would open his church doors to the entire community. Facilitating an open house, he said would be a way for people to join in prayer, fellowship, and grief as well as unite in a mission to help those suffering in Haiti.

"This is an opportunity to see people come together, share and help," said Carter.

To donate to the Unitarian Universalist Service Committee, which is donating to the crisis in Haiti, you can visit their website: www.uusc.org
